Cisco Systems Inc
TECHNOLOGY · COMMUNICATION EQUIPMENT · USA
Cisco Systems, Inc. is an American multinational technology conglomerate headquartered in San Jose, California, in the center of Silicon Valley. Cisco develops, manufactures and sells networking hardware, software, telecommunications equipment and other high-technology services and products. Through its numerous acquired subsidiaries, such as OpenDNS, Webex, Jabber and Jasper, Cisco specializes in specific tech markets, such as the Internet of Things (IoT), domain security and energy management. On January 25, 2021, Cisco reincorporated in Delaware.

TECHNOLOGY · COMMUNICATION EQUIPMENT · USA
Lumentum Holdings Inc. manufactures and sells optical and photonic products in the Americas, Asia-Pacific,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. The company is headquartered in San Jose, California.
